The cheapest way to get from Genêts to Beauvoir is to line 308 bus which costs €4 - €7 and takes 59 min.
The fastest way to get from Genêts to Beauvoir is to drive which takes 27 min and costs €5 - €8.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from La Poste and arriving at Parking Navettes. Services depart once da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 59 min.
The distance between Genêts and Beauvoir is 33 km. The road distance is 32.5 km.
The best way to get from Genêts to Beauvoir without a car is to line 308 bus which takes 59 min and costs €4 - €7.
The line 308 bus from La Poste to Parking Navettes takes 59 min including transfers and departs once daily.
Genêts to Beauvoir bus services, operated by Réseau Nomad Car (Lignes de Normandie), depart from La Poste station.
Genêts to Beauvoir bus services, operated by Réseau Nomad Car (Lignes de Normandie), arrive at Parking Navettes station.
Yes, the driving distance between Genêts to Beauvoir is 32 km. It takes approximately 27 min to drive from Genêts to Beauvoir.
